Aphid Parasitoids: Aphidiinae (Hym., Braconidae)
2021Various aspects of the knowledge on the aphid parasitoids (Hymenoptera, Aphidiinae) with regards to the biological control of pest aphids are presented. The aphidiines are exclusively associated with aphids and can be found in various natural and agro-ecosystems.

A survey of aphid parasitoids (Hymenoptera: Braconidae: Aphidiinae) in Diyarbakır, Turkey
Phytoparasitica, 2003A list is given of aphid parasitoids found in Diyarbakir Province, Turkey. In the survey, performed between 1998 and 2000, 16 species of aphid parasitoids were found on different hosts in Diyarbakir Province.Monoctonus mali is reported for the first time in the Turkish aphid parasitoids fauna.

Are generalist Aphidiinae (Hym. Braconidae) mostly cryptic species complexes?
Systematic Entomology, 2015Abstract Aphidiinae are mostly composed of specialist parasitoids and the few species described as generalist are suspected to be composed of cryptic specialists, almost indistinguishable based on morphological characteristics.
